General Purpose and Scope of Position:

The pilot/aerial application role is responsible for the safe operation of rotary wing aircraft in the application of plant protection, seed and nutrition products on agricultural crops and Industrial forestry. Pilots should have an understanding of plant protection, chemistries, fertilizer and seed. Pilots need to have open and positive communication with their supervisor, agronomists, coworkers and the grower or customer. Process work orders against scheduled dates and time, properly complete necessary paperwork (application records, shipping papers, daily driver report, and all info on work orders).

Key Skills and Abilities Include:

  • Comply with FAA Regulations
  • Current U.S. commercial pilot certificate
  • Current agricultural aircraft operator certificate or able to obtain – state-specific
  • 1,000+ hr. Rotorcraft preferred.
  • Turbine Rotorcraft experience preferred.
  • Aerial application experience preferred.
  • Familiar with SatLoc GPS swath guidance system.
  • Accurately locate the application site.
  • Lift containers weighing up to 80 lbs.
  • Class C Commercial driver's license required or able to obtain.
  • Ability to travel and work on the road.
  • Ability to manage a small team of individuals.

Specific Responsibilities and Key Deliverables Include:

  • Proper application of plant protection products.
  • Properly handle and store all chemical containers.
  • Comply with label requirements and restrictions for the aerial application of pesticides.
  • Process work orders against scheduled dates and times.
  • Comply with all applicable laws and regulations at all times.
  • Follow all Wilbur-Ellis Company safety rules.
  • Check each field for in-flight hazards (towers, power lines, wires, irrigation pipes and vent pipes) before each application begins.
  • Ensure any equipment deficiencies have been addressed and reported to the manager.
  • Participate in blood testing and/or alcohol testing when scheduled.
  • Assist with maintenance and other duties as needed at the facility.
  • Maintain and care for aircraft according to generally- accepted maintenance practices.
